The 2025 edition of the Pharmacopoeia of the People's Republic of China (hereinafter referred to as the "Chinese Pharmacopoeia") has been promulgated by the State Food and Drug Administration and the National Health Commission Announcement No. 29 of 2025 and will be implemented from October 1, 2025. The relevant matters concerning the implementation of this edition of the Chinese Pharmacopoeia are hereby announced as follows:
1. According to the provisions of the Drug Administration Law, drugs shall comply with national drug standards. The Chinese Pharmacopoeia is an important part of the national drug standards, and is a statutory technical standard that should be followed by relevant units such as drug development, production (import), operation, use, supervision and management.
2. The Chinese Pharmacopoeia mainly includes examples, varieties and texts, general technical requirements and guidelines. From the date of implementation, all marketing authorization holders and drugs produced and marketed shall implement the relevant requirements of this announcement and this edition of the Chinese Pharmacopoeia. Among them, the relevant requirements of the guiding principles are the recommended technical requirements.

From the date of implementation, all varieties originally included in the previous editions of the Pharmacopoeia and the standards issued by the Bureau (Ministry) and the current edition of the Chinese Pharmacopoeia shall be abolished at the same time as the corresponding previous editions of the Pharmacopoeia and the standards issued by the Bureau (Ministry); If this edition of the Chinese Pharmacopoeia is not included, the corresponding previous editions of the Pharmacopoeia and the standards issued by the bureau (ministry) shall still be implemented, but shall meet the relevant general technical requirements of this edition of the Chinese Pharmacopoeia. For varieties that have been revoked or cancelled after post-marketing evaluation, the corresponding previous editions of the pharmacopoeia and the standards issued by the bureau (ministry) shall be abolished.
